§ 100-B:7 — Vesting; Points to Remain in Plan

I.A member shall have a nonforfeitable right to a percentage of a service award that is not less than the percentage determined under the following table: Years of Service Nonforfeitable Percentage 6 years 20 7 years 40 8 years 60 9 years 80 10 years or More 100
II.Notwithstanding the preceding table, a member shall have a 100 percent nonforfeitable right to the member's service award upon the member's attainment of the entitlement age under the plan, including any increase in benefits provided for in an amendment of a service awards program.
